linux重复上一个命令快捷键
-
在Linux系统中,重复上一个命令有多种快捷键可以使用。下面列举了两种常用的方法:
1. 使用上箭头键(↑):按下上箭头键可以在命令行中逐步回溯之前输入的命令。重复上一个命令的快捷键就是按下回车键执行当前显示的命令。
2. 使用历史命令快捷键:可以使用历史命令快捷键来重复执行之前的命令。下面是一些常用的历史命令快捷键:
– !!:执行上一个命令。
– !n:执行历史命令列表中第n个命令,n为命令在列表中的序号。
– !-n:执行倒数第n个命令。
– !字符串:执行最近以字符串开头的命令。
– Ctrl + R:使用反向搜索历史命令。按下Ctrl + R后,可以输入关键字来搜索之前输入的命令,然后按下Enter键执行搜索到的命令。
以上是Linux系统中常用的重复上一个命令的快捷键。通过这些快捷键,可以方便地执行之前输入过的命令,提高工作效率。
2年前 -
在Linux中,可以使用以下方法来重复上一个命令:
1. 使用上箭头键(↑):在终端中,按下↑键可以将上一个使用过的命令显示出来。按下回车键即可重复执行上一个命令。
2. 使用历史命令号:每个命令都有一个唯一的编号,可以使用history命令来查看历史命令列表及其对应的编号。然后可以使用“!编号”的方式来运行特定的历史命令。
3. 使用“!!”符号:在终端中,输入两个连续的感叹号“!!”,然后按下回车键,即可重复执行上一个命令。
4. 使用“!-1”符号:在终端中,输入“!-1”,然后按下回车键,即可重复执行上一个命令。
5. 使用Ctrl + P:在终端中,按下Ctrl + P键组合,即可重复执行上一个命令。
需要注意的是,以上方法只能重复执行最近的一条命令。如果想要重复执行更早的命令,可以使用历史命令列表来选择需要重复执行的命令。
此外,还可以使用终端中提供的其他命令行编辑功能来重复执行命令。如使用Ctrl + R来进行向后搜索历史命令,并直接执行匹配的命令。或使用Ctrl + S来进行向前搜索历史命令,并直接执行匹配的命令。
2年前 -
在Linux系统中,有几种方法可以快速重复上一个命令。下面将介绍三种常用的方法。
方法一:使用上键(↑)
在终端上按下上键(↑)会将上一次输入的命令重新显示出来。按下回车键即可执行该命令。这是最简单、最直接的一种方式。方法二:使用历史命令
Linux提供了一个历史命令(history)来查看之前执行过的命令。通过使用“history”命令,可以列出所有执行过的命令的编号及其对应的命令内容。然后可以使用“!”符号加上命令的编号来执行某个历史命令。例如,要执行第100个历史命令,可以输入“!100”。另外,还可以使用“!!”来执行上一个命令。例如,输入“!!”并按下回车键,即可执行上一个命令。
方法三:使用“Ctrl + R”反向搜索命令
这种方法可以根据输入的关键字搜索之前使用过的命令,并执行搜索结果中的命令。具体使用方法如下:
1. 在终端上按下“Ctrl + R”组合键,会出现一个反向搜索的提示符。
2. 输入关键字,在命令历史中进行搜索。终端会自动显示匹配的命令。
3. 可以继续按下“Ctrl + R”,以在匹配的命令中进行切换。
4. 当找到要执行的命令后,按下回车键即可执行。使用这种方法时,可以使用完整或部分命令进行搜索。例如,输入“git”后,系统会显示最近使用过的所有包含“git”关键字的命令。这样可以很方便地找到并重复执行之前输入的命令。
总结:
无论是使用上键(↑)来重复上一个命令,使用历史命令来执行指定的命令,还是使用“Ctrl + R”来反向搜索并执行命令,都可以让我们在Linux系统中更加高效地使用命令行。选择其中一种方法,根据个人喜好和操作习惯来使用。这些方法不仅适用于Linux系统,也适用于其他基于UNIX的系统,如macOS。2年前